P0011 on 2007-2014 Cadillac Escalade ESV: Cam Timing Causes and Fixes

On a 2007-2014 Escalade ESV, P0011 is most often caused by low/dirty engine oil or a faulty Bank 1 (driver's side) intake camshaft position actuator solenoid. A new ACDelco solenoid costs about $40-$70 and is a common, accessible DIY fix. However, always check oil level and condition first, as low oil pressure from issues like a bad pickup tube O-ring is a very common underlying cause on this platform.

⚠️ Drivable, but... — You can drive, but expect symptoms like rough idling, poor acceleration, stalling, and reduced fuel economy. Ignoring the code for an extended period could lead to internal engine damage or harm to the catalytic converters. GM TSBs also note this code can lead to a crank-no-start condition, potentially leaving you stranded.
Key Takeaways
  • Always check your engine oil level and condition first; this is the easiest and a very common fix for P0011.
  • The most likely failed part is the Bank 1 (driver's side) intake camshaft actuator solenoid (ACDelco #12655420).
  • Swapping the intake solenoids between the driver's and passenger's side is a no-cost diagnostic step to confirm a failed solenoid.
  • If a new solenoid and fresh oil don't fix the code, you must investigate for low oil pressure, as recommended by GM's own service bulletins. [Bulletin #PIP5258]
The trouble code P0011 stands for "'A' Camshaft Position - Timing Over-Advanced or System Performance (Bank 1)". On your Escalade's V8 engine, this means the Engine Control Module (ECM) has detected that the intake camshaft for Bank 1 (the passenger side of the engine) is more advanced than the ECM has commanded it to be. The Variable Valve Timing (VVT) system, which is operated by engine oil pressure, adjusts camshaft timing to improve performance and fuel economy, but this code indicates a problem with that adjustment process.

What's Unique About the 2007-2014 Cadillac ESCALADE ESV

The 6.2L V8 engine found in a 2007-2014 Cadillac Escalade ESV.
The 6.2L V8 engine (L92/L94) in the GMT900 Escalade relies on precise oil pressure to operate the VVT system.

The 6.2L V8 engine (L92, L9H, L94) in the third-generation Escalade uses a hydraulic VVT system that is highly sensitive to engine oil pressure and cleanliness. While the camshaft actuator solenoid is a frequent failure point, this specific GMT900 platform can be difficult to diagnose because underlying oil pressure issues can also trigger the P0011 code, a fact highlighted in multiple GM Technical Service Bulletins. Owners have reported chasing this code, sometimes replacing many parts, only to find the root cause was a failing oil pump or a hardened oil pickup tube O-ring affecting pressure. The later L94 engine variant (2010-2014) also includes Active Fuel Management (AFM), which can contribute to oil consumption and pressure issues that indirectly trigger VVT codes.

Symptoms You May Notice

  • Check Engine Light is on
  • Service Stabilitrak / Traction Control light may also illuminate
  • Rough or erratic idle
  • Engine stalling, especially at low speeds or after exiting the highway
  • Poor acceleration and reduced engine power
  • Difficulty starting the engine or crank-no-start condition
  • Decreased fuel economy
  • Rattling or ticking noise from the engine, particularly on startup
  • Vehicle "rides horrible" once the light is on. [ODI #10888068]
⚠️ Don't Waste Money on the Wrong Fix
  • Replacing the Camshaft Position *Sensor* instead of the Actuator *Solenoid*. The sensor reads the position, but the solenoid controls the oil flow to move the phaser. P0011 is a performance code almost always caused by the solenoid or an oiling issue, not the sensor itself.
  • Repeatedly replacing VVT solenoids without addressing an underlying low oil pressure problem. If a new solenoid fixes the code for only a short time, the root cause is likely oil pressure related to the pickup tube O-ring or oil pump.

Most Likely Causes

A comparison between a clean, new VVT solenoid and one clogged with engine oil sludge and debris.
A clean solenoid (left) allows proper oil flow, while a sludgy or clogged solenoid (right) is the primary cause of P0011 codes.
  1. Low or Dirty Engine Oil 🔴 High Probability The VVT system is hydraulically operated and highly dependent on oil volume, pressure, and cleanliness. Sludge or low levels can impede the function of the actuator solenoid and cam phaser. Using oil that does not meet the Dexos1 Gen2 standard can also contribute to issues.
    How to confirm: Check the oil level on the dipstick and inspect the oil's condition. If it is low, dark, or sludgy, this is the likely cause. An oil change is the first and most important diagnostic step.
    Typical fix: Perform an oil and filter change using the manufacturer-recommended oil weight (typically 5W-30 full synthetic meeting Dexos1 spec) and a quality filter like an ACDelco PF48.
    Est. part cost: $40-$80
  2. Faulty Camshaft Position Actuator Solenoid (VVT Solenoid) 🔴 High Probability This solenoid is a known failure point mentioned in GM TSB #PIP5130K. Internal screens can get clogged with debris, or the solenoid coil can fail, causing it to stick open or closed.
    How to confirm: Swap the Bank 1 (driver's side) intake solenoid with the Bank 2 (passenger's side) intake solenoid. Clear the codes and drive. If the code changes to P0021 (Bank 2), the solenoid is confirmed bad. Alternatively, remove the solenoid and inspect its screens for sludge or debris.
    Typical fix: Replace the Bank 1 intake camshaft position actuator solenoid. It is located on the front of the driver's side cylinder head, held by a single 10mm bolt. Using an OEM ACDelco part is highly recommended.
    Est. part cost: $40-$70
  3. Low Engine Oil Pressure (Pickup Tube O-Ring) 🟡 Medium Probability The O-ring on the oil pump pickup tube can become hard and brittle over time, allowing the pump to suck in air. This aerates the oil, reduces pressure, and starves the VVT system, triggering P0011 even if other components are good. This is a well-documented issue on GMT900 trucks and SUVs, with many owner-confirmed fixes.
    How to confirm: Connect a mechanical oil pressure gauge. At hot idle, pressure should be at least 20-22 PSI. If pressure is low (e.g., 10-15 PSI) or fluctuates wildly, this is a likely cause.
    Typical fix: Replace the oil pickup tube O-ring. This requires removing the oil pan for access, which on AWD models involves lowering the front differential. It is recommended to use the updated, typically red or orange, GM O-ring.
    Est. part cost: $5-$20
  4. Faulty Camshaft Phaser (Actuator) ⚪ Low Probability The phaser itself, which is the gear on the end of the camshaft, can fail internally. It can get stuck in the advanced position due to debris, a broken locking pin, or clogged oil passages.
    How to confirm: This is typically diagnosed after replacing the solenoid and confirming oil pressure is good. It requires removing the valve cover and potentially the timing cover to inspect. A scan tool may show the commanded vs. actual cam angle being stuck.
    Typical fix: Replace the camshaft phaser. This is a more labor-intensive job that often involves replacing the timing chain and tensioner at the same time.
    Est. part cost: $100-$250

Rare But Worth Checking

  • Incorrect Camshaft Part Installed: According to GM TSB #PIP5115, if the code appears immediately after a camshaft replacement, the wrong part number may have been installed. The technician should verify the part number on the camshaft itself. [⭐ MANUFACTURER TSB — highest authority] Bulletin #PIP5115
  • Stretched Timing Chain or Failed Tensioner: While not the most common cause, a stretched timing chain or a broken plastic tensioner can cause camshaft timing to deviate enough from the crankshaft position to set this code. This is usually accompanied by rattling noises from the front of the engine.
  • Worn Camshaft Bearings: As a last resort, TSB #PIP5258A suggests inspecting the #2 cam bearing. Excessive wear on this specific bearing can cause a localized oil pressure drop to the VVT actuator, triggering P0011 even if overall engine pressure seems acceptable. This is a major engine repair.

Diagnosis Steps

  1. Check Engine Oil Level and Condition: Ensure the oil is full and clean. If low, dirty, or not the correct 5W-30 Dexos-spec synthetic, perform an oil and filter change, clear the code, and see if it returns.
  2. Scan for Other Codes: Check for any other related codes (like P0010, P0021, P0521) that can help pinpoint the issue.
  3. Test the VVT Solenoid: Swap the Bank 1 (driver's side) intake solenoid with the Bank 2 (passenger's side) intake solenoid. Clear codes and drive. If the code returns as P0021, the solenoid you moved is faulty and needs replacement.
  4. Inspect Solenoid and Wiring: Before swapping, remove the Bank 1 solenoid and inspect its mesh screens for sludge or metal debris. A clogged screen confirms an oil quality issue. Also, check the connector and wiring to the solenoid for any damage, corrosion, or loose connections.
  5. Test Engine Oil Pressure: If the solenoid is good, use a mechanical gauge to test oil pressure at the oil pressure sender location. At hot idle, it should be above 20-22 PSI. If it's low, suspect an issue like the oil pickup tube O-ring or a failing oil pump. This step is explicitly recommended by GM TSB #PIP5258A when other diagnostics fail.
  6. Inspect Cam Phaser and Timing Components: If oil pressure is good, the final step is to inspect the cam phaser for damage and the timing chain for excessive slack. This is an advanced step requiring significant disassembly.

Related Codes That Often Appear With This One

  • P0010 — This code indicates an electrical circuit problem with the same Bank 1 intake VVT solenoid, pointing directly to a bad solenoid or wiring issue.
  • P0021 — This is the equivalent code for Bank 2 (passenger side). Seeing it after swapping solenoids from Bank 1 to Bank 2 is a definitive diagnosis of a bad solenoid.
  • P0521 — This code indicates an issue with the Engine Oil Pressure Sensor/Switch. If seen with P0011, it strongly suggests the root cause is a lack of oil pressure, not a faulty VVT component. [Bulletin #PIP5258A, 14]

Technical Service Bulletins (TSBs) & Recalls

  • PIP5115: Advises checking the camshaft part number if P0011 appears immediately after a camshaft replacement. [⭐ MANUFACTURER TSB — highest authority]
  • PIP5258 / PIP5258A: Instructs technicians to check mechanical oil pressure and inspect the #2 cam bearing if standard P0011 diagnostics fail. [8, ⭐ MANUFACTURER TSB — highest authority]
  • PIP5130K: Notes that a sticking Camshaft Position Actuator Solenoid Valve can cause P0011 and crank-no-start conditions, recommending cycling the solenoid with a scan tool to free it. [1, 3, ⭐ MANUFACTURER TSB — highest authority]

Platform-Specific Known Issues

  • As noted in GM TSBs #PIP5258 and #PIP5258A, if standard diagnostics for P0011 do not reveal the cause, the technician should immediately investigate engine oil pressure with a mechanical gauge. The TSB specifically mentions checking the #2 cam bearing as the oil feed for the actuator. [1, 8, ⭐ MANUFACTURER TSB — highest authority] Bulletin #PIP5258, [⭐ MANUFACTURER TSB — highest authority] Bulletin #PIP5258A

Mechanic-Grade Diagnostic Values

A mechanical oil pressure gauge connected to an engine showing a PSI reading.
Verifying actual oil pressure with a mechanical gauge is critical for diagnosing P0011 on high-mileage Escalades.
  • Camshaft Position Actuator Solenoid Resistance — expected: 8-13 Ohms. Failure: A reading outside this range, or an open/infinite reading, indicates a faulty solenoid coil.
  • Engine Oil Pressure (at hot idle) — expected: Greater than 20-22 PSI. Failure: Pressure below this threshold, especially when hot, points to oiling issues like a bad pickup tube O-ring or worn pump.
  • Scan Tool Camshaft Position Variance — expected: Less than 8 degrees. Failure: The ECM will set code P0011 if the difference between the desired and actual camshaft position angle is greater than 8 degrees for a set period of time.

Scan Tool Commands That Help

  • GM GDS2 / Tech2: Camshaft Position Actuator Solenoid Control — This bidirectional control allows a technician to command the solenoid to a specific angle (e.g., 25 degrees) and back to zero. Observing the 'CMP Angle' vs 'Desired CMP' PIDs on the scan tool during this test can confirm if the phaser is physically stuck or if the solenoid is lazy/non-responsive, helping to distinguish a mechanical fault from an oil pressure or electrical issue.

Wiring & Ground Locations

  • G103 & G104 — G103 is on the front of the right (passenger side) cylinder head. G104 is on the front of the left (driver's side) cylinder head.. These are primary engine grounds used by the Engine Control Module (ECM). A poor connection at these points can cause erratic voltage and unpredictable behavior from sensors and actuators, including the VVT system.
  • VVT Solenoid Connector — On the front of the driver's side cylinder head, connected to the VVT solenoid. It is a 2-pin connector.. This is the direct electrical connection. Terminal A is the control circuit from the ECM, and Terminal B is the low reference (ground) circuit. Testing for voltage, ground, and resistance should be done at these pins.

Model Year Variations Within This Range

  • 2007-2009: These years primarily used the 6.2L L92 engine, which has VVT but does not have Active Fuel Management (AFM). Diagnostics for P0011 on these models can focus more directly on the VVT system and general oil pressure without the added complexity of potential AFM-related lifter failure causing oil pressure loss.
  • 2010-2014: These years used the 6.2L L94 engine (and L9H for FlexFuel), which added Active Fuel Management (AFM) to the VVT system. For these models, a P0011 code must be diagnosed with the consideration that a failing AFM lifter could be the root cause of an oil pressure drop that subsequently triggers the VVT fault code.
